Starfield Beta 1.10.30: Improved character models

Starfield Update 1.10.30 Beta Notes

Yesterday, Bethesda released Starfield Beta Update 1.10.30 for Steam, allowing players to experience forthcoming changes across all platforms. This update prioritizes quality-of-life enhancements, particularly focusing on expanding creative freedom within the game’s photo mode.

Digipick Fix and Other Quality-of-Life Improvements

The update addresses a longstanding concern about the Security mini-game and its penalty for mistakes, directly targeting issues users encountered in the Digipick acquisition process. Eliminating the Digipick loss from “undoing” actions within this minigame significantly improves the overall gameplay experience, particularly for those who have encountered frustration with this element of the game. Moreover, the update incorporates additional quality-of-life improvements, refining the ship user interface for smoother performance at higher frame rates, adding support for adjusting the field of view (FOV) in third-person ship views, and introducing an anisotropic filtering quality slider for PC users.

Addressing the “Sabotage” Quest and Beyond

The update also tackles a bug concerning the Ryujin Industries quest “Sabotage,” a mission previously plagued by issues with NPC spawns. This fix resolves the obstacle preventing players from completing the quest due to a missing NPC, allowing players to continue their storyline progression without interruption. Detailed Beta Notes: Features and Fixes

The 1.10.30 beta update brings a wide range of features and fixes to Starfield, addressing various aspects of gameplay and graphical elements.

  • Photo Mode Enhancements: New facial expressions and poses for both the player and companions are now available in photo mode.
  • Gameplay Improvements: The ability to open doors and harvest while scanning has been added. A new auto-save function activates when traveling from a planet’s surface to orbit. Setting a course on an inactive quest will now make it the active quest. The Digipick penalty for using Undo in the Security mini-game has been removed.
  • Graphics Improvements: Visual issues such as gaps and misplaced objects across various locations are fixed throughout the game world.
